Risks and Considerations Before Buying
When selecting patio umbrellas at Amazon, it’s essential to be aware of potential pitfalls that can affect your purchase decision. Understanding these risks can help you choose an umbrella that not only fits your outdoor space but also meets your durability and maintenance expectations.
-
Durability Issues Based on Material: Different materials offer varying degrees of durability. For instance, polyester fabrics are often less expensive but may fade or tear more quickly than solution-dyed acrylic options. Evaluate the material to ensure it can withstand the elements in your area.
-
Wind Resistance and Safety Concerns: Not all patio umbrellas are designed to handle strong winds. If you live in a windy area, consider umbrellas with sturdy frames and features like vented canopies to reduce the risk of tipping over or being damaged. A lack of wind resistance can lead to safety hazards and potential injury.
-
Maintenance Requirements and Longevity: Some umbrellas require more maintenance than others. Fabrics that are easy to clean and resistant to mold or mildew are preferable for long-term use. Additionally, consider how often you will need to store the umbrella to protect it from harsh weather, as this can affect its longevity.

How do I maintain my patio umbrella for longevity?
Proper maintenance can extend the life of your patio umbrella:
- Regular Cleaning: Wipe down the fabric and frame with mild soap and water to prevent mold and mildew buildup.
- Storage: When not in use, especially during harsh weather, store the umbrella in a dry place or use a protective cover.
- Inspection: Periodically check for any damage, such as tears in the fabric or rust on the frame, and address these issues promptly to prevent further deterioration.
